
What percent of 84 is 21?

Hint: To find what percent of 84 is 21. Firstly we will divide 21 by 84 as we have to find the percent of 21 from 84. Then we will simplify the ratio obtained. Next for getting it in percentage we will multiply the obtained value by 100 and add the percentage sign to get the desired answer.
Complete step by step solution:
To obtain what percent of 84 is 21 we will divide 21 by 84 as follows:
$\dfrac{21}{84}$
Now, as we can see that both numerator and denominator have two common factors i.e. 3 and 7
So, we will simplify the above value by dividing the numerator and denominator by 3 and get,
$\begin{align}
& \Rightarrow \dfrac{\dfrac{21}{3}}{\dfrac{84}{3}} \\
& \Rightarrow \dfrac{7}{28} \\
\end{align}$
Again on dividing numerator and denominator by 7 we get,
$\begin{align}
& \Rightarrow \dfrac{\dfrac{7}{7}}{\dfrac{28}{7}} \\
& \Rightarrow \dfrac{1}{4} \\
\end{align}$
$\therefore \dfrac{21}{84}=\dfrac{1}{4}$…….$\left( 1 \right)$
Now, we will multiply right side of the equation (1) by 100 and get,
$\begin{align}
& \Rightarrow \dfrac{1}{4}\times 100 \\
& \Rightarrow 25\% \\
\end{align}$
Hence 21 is $25\%$ of 84.
Note: The percentage term used is a number or we can say ratio which is expressed as a fraction of 100. It is denoted by percent sign $\%$. It doesn’t have any unit of measurement. Percentage means a part per hundred. It can be represented in decimal form; the most common use of percentage is in exams where the percent of the total marks in all subjects is calculated for every student. We can also use a direct method to find the solution. The formula is:
$P\%$ of Number $=X$…..$\left( 2 \right)$
The Number $=84$
$X=21$
Substituting above value in equation (2) we get,
$\begin{align}
& P\%\times 84=21 \\
& \dfrac{P}{100}=\dfrac{21}{84} \\
& P=\dfrac{21}{84}\times 100 \\
& P=25\% \\
\end{align}$
